Through his training and experience as a U.S. Marine and his in-depth research of the topics covered in this book, J. Brett Earnest shares information that could save you and your family when terrorists strike.

Should you fight, or remain passive?
What is a dirty bomb and what should you do if one explodes nearby?
How do you decontaminate yourself using items found in your home after a radiological, chemical, or biological agent attack?
Where can you find safe drinking water in an emergency?
What can you do to save yourself from knives, clubs, or gunfire?
How do you find or create shelter to save you and your family from blasts, poisons, or radiation?
What are your options for survival when riding mass transit buses, trams, and boats?
What supplies should you have in your shelter, and how much of each item?
Which kinds of radios and telephones are reliable in an emergency?

The answers to these questions and more are in this book, possibly making it the most important book you will ever buy.
